Position title
Noc Analyst 1
Description
- The NOC Analyst I will be responsible for monitoring and maintaining our network and systems to ensure optimal performance and uptime.
- This entry-level position offers the opportunity for growth and development within our organization.
- Manage Windows and Network Device Patching troubleshooting and resolution, as well as pro-active engagement for critical items.
- Find the systems that did not patch or do not meet the VC3 criteria from the patching reports. Verify that systems are doing patching.
- Analyze the root causes of the patching failures and categorize them by severity, impact, and urgency.
- Communicate the patching issues and remediation plans to the relevant stakeholders, including the clients, NOC Analyst
- Manager, and the technical teams.
- Execute the remediation plans according to the agreed schedule and monitor the progress and results.
- Identification and troubleshooting of complex network and system issues, escalating as necessary.
- Maintain accurate documentation of network and system configurations and changes.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to resolve issues and implement solutions.
- Ensure all Tickets are properly created and notated to account for time.
- Perform patching audits and confirm systems are receiving patches.
- Follow playbook for patching and updating and managed systems.
- Maintain accurate and real time timesheets, record complete and accurate notes of troubleshooting and communication with clients.
- Where appropriate, escalate complicated issues to a more senior resource or other appropriate teams.
- Review Tickets KPI’s with NOC Overnight Manager.
- Participate in Team Huddles, L10 Meetings, One on One
- Meetings, and any other necessary Team Meetings.
Qualifications
- Applicants must be a PERMANENT RESIDENT in the Philippines.
- 2+ years of experience in network and system monitoring or related field.
- Experience with network and system monitoring tools; ConnectWise Ticketing, OpenDNS, Kaseya VSA, and PRTG a plus.
- Knowledge of advanced networking concepts such as load balancing, VPN, and firewalls.
- Advanced understanding of server and operating system concepts, including Windows and Linux.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work independently and in a team-oriented environment.
- Attention to detail and ability to prioritize multiple tasks, as well as to direct others on proper task prioritization.
- Will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ies and processes.
